Meaning & origin

Parnika is a modern name of Sanskrit origin, first recorded in the United States in 2003, and has been rising in usage since 2005. It reached its peak popularity in 2018, though even then it remained rare, with a rank of 5,917th and approximately 1 in 80,363 girls receiving the name in 2023. The name is built on the Sanskrit root 'parna' (leaf) and the feminine suffix '-ika', giving it a gentle, nature-inspired feel. While not yet common enough to appear in top state rankings, Parnika has found favor among families seeking a distinctive yet culturally rooted name. It is predominantly used for girls and has steadily climbed in interest over the past two decades, reflecting broader trends toward unique, international names.

Parnika is likely derived from the Sanskrit word 'parna' meaning 'leaf' or 'foliage', with the suffix '-ika' forming a feminine diminutive. The name has been used in modern India, especially since the early 2000s, though its exact origin remains debated.
